New Evidence on GLP-1 Drugs and Breast Cancer Survival
Research published in JAMA Network Open provides evidence of a positive link between GLP-1 receptor agonists and improved results for breast cancer patients. These medications treat obesity and diabetes. The findings point to lower overall death risk over 10 years among users.
Breast cancer survivors using GLP-1 receptor agonists for diabetes or obesity showed a much lower chance of cancer returning within 10 years after initial treatment. The study highlights potential benefits for patients facing higher risks due to obesity or type 2 diabetes. Obese or diabetic breast cancer patients often see more aggressive tumor growth and poorer survival rates.
Previous research links weight loss treatments and surgery after diagnosis to better heart health and longer life. GLP-1 agonist prescriptions have risen sharply since 2020. A RAND report states that about 12% of Americans have taken these drugs for weight loss.
Study Design and Patient Data
Investigators conducted a retrospective cohort study using electronic health records. They reviewed data from more than 840,000 breast cancer patients diagnosed between 2006 and 2023. The analysis focused on those with obesity or type 2 diabetes.
GLP-1 receptor agonist use correlated with decreased risk of death from any cause during a 10-year follow-up. Users also had lower recurrence rates over the same period. These patterns appeared specific to patients with added risks from weight or diabetes.
The results match early lab studies and add to evidence on GLP-1 receptor agonists in cancer care, according to Kristina L. Tatum, PsyD, MS, of the VCU School of Public Health. Tatum served as lead author. "Our findings align with emerging preclinical research and contribute to a growing body of literature related to GLP-1 RA use in oncology settings," she said.
Insights from Study Leaders
Bernard F. Fuemmeler, Ph.D., MPH, offered key perspective as senior author. He holds the role of associate director for population sciences and the Gordon D. Ginder, M.D., Chair in Cancer Research at VCU Massey Comprehensive Cancer Center. "This study suggests that GLP-1 drugs may offer protective benefits potentially improving survival and recurrence risk in some female patients with breast cancer, whether this is related to weight control, improve cardiovascular health or other mechanisms remains to be studied," Fuemmeler stated.
Fuemmeler emphasized the promise of these drugs as extra support for breast cancer care. "Our study underscores the potential of GLP-1 RAs as an adjunct strategy for improving cancer-related outcomes among patients with breast cancer, although clinical trials are needed to inform effective therapeutic approaches and clinical decision making," he added.
Calls for Further Investigation
More work is required to clarify any direct biological effects of GLP-1 receptor agonists on breast cancer results. The research group plans randomized clinical trials to test these links. Such trials will guide treatment choices and decisions in clinics.
